I created a website and it is working on all browsers except internet explorer.
But when I go by ip address it even works in internet explorer!

I am using Forms authentication, cookies mode, so I found that the internet explorer is restricting the site .

How can I succeed in making it work?

Well, it's not related to your application as such. This is more of network security thing which can be handled at IT level. Every company has few sites allowed and blocked. It's kind of allowing your hosted website to be safe and browsable.

Current solution is to verify if that works (which it should). And then the actual production scenario would be to convey your client that the hosted weburl is a trusted one and their IT team needs to allow access to it (once IT allows access, no need to add to trusted site individually.)
Select Tools->Internet Options -> Security Tab -> Select Trusted Sites -> Click Sites button -> Add your website addess in it.
